Slides from my "Usability Testing How To's" workshop with Event Handler. http://www.eventhandler.co.uk/events/uxnightclass-usability Westminster Hub, London UK 24 October 2013 === Who is it for? This workshop is for those who want to create products that will be easy to use. Usability testing is an important part of the process of designing digital products, but it can often be overlooked due to time, money, and training constraints. In this workshop you'll learn how to test any product's usability without spending a large amount of time and money. And how to use what you've learned to improve the product. Who is it taught by? This workshop is being taught by Evgenia Grinblo @grinblo, User Experience Specialist at mobile agency, Future Workshops. Born in Siberia, Jenny freelanced and trained in ethnographic research in Israel and the USA, before bringing her talent to the UK. Her pet peeve is badly written error-messages and she has a growing collection of them. You'll find her speaking on empathy, UX, and other passions. What you'll learn An introduction to usability testing - what is it? Who should you test your product on? What do you test? How to facilitate a test and get reliable results How to manage data and act on your findings with your team Tools: Cheap, quick and effective testing tools for mobile and the web.

Facilitating

‣ Practice staying quiet

‣ Remind the participant to speak out loud

‣ Don’t give anything away

‣ Be reassuring, say thank you

‣ If they get stuck, wait (a little)

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 95: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Facilitator Cheat-Sheet

If they forget to think aloud

‣ "What are you thinking right now?"

‣ "What are you finding confusing on this screen?"

‣ "I know it's an unusual thing to do but could I please ask you to keep thinking out loud and talk as you go along? It really helps me understand your experience better."

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 96: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Facilitator Cheat-Sheet

If they get stuck

‣ "This is very helpful for us, we are uncovering a lot of problems in the design that will help us make the app better."

‣ "I can already see how useful this is going to be in improving the app."

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 97: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Facilitator Cheat-Sheet

If they have a question

‣ "Please continue in the way that makes sense to you. We will learn a lot from seeing how you proceed with this without any help."

‣ "I will be happy to answer your questions at the end. Please try to try this task for a bit longer."

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 98: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Facilitator Cheat-Sheet

The golden go-to

‣ "We expected to uncover problems in the design. You are not doing anything wrong - we knew there would be issues and you are helping us find them."

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Note-taking tips

Only record what’s important

‣ If someone is really happy

‣ If someone is really frustrated

‣ If someone fails a task

‣ Write down short quotes if you can

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 108: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Notes Example

• Taps Map on merchant profile but this opens the system Maps

app — confused

• Goes to Search and types “coffee shops” but there are no results

— “why can’t I see what’s around me?”

• "If I had to think about something around me, I’d start the

merchant profile and expect to see other things around me"

• The icons aren’t telling me that Cafe Nero is a coffee shop

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 109: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

What to bring to the testPrinted scenarios & tasks for participant

Printed scenarios & tasks with success paths for facilitator

Facilitator script

Optional: List of pre-test and debrief questions

Consent form (if needed)

Pen + paper / recording tools

Test setup checklist

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

Page 110: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Setting up the testReset the mobile app / site to the default settings

Clear the test area of any open documents, written notes, etc.

Prepare participant forms: scenarios, intro script, consent form

Optional: Verify the recording equipment

Optional: Make sure the brightness on the screen is reduced

FACILITATING A TEST & RECORDING RESULTS

What to do with all the data?

‣ Identify changes with the biggest impact & smallest effort as a team

‣ Find the “low-hanging fruit”

‣ What has impact on the bottom line?

‣ Put everything else in the ice-box

ANALYSING & PRESENTING FINDINGS

Page 116: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Identifying key findings

High-priority: people fail, or abandon the task

Medium: people succeed but are frustrated and unhappy

Low: people would enjoy the app more if...

ANALYSING & PRESENTING FINDINGS

Page 117: Usability Testing How To's - EventHandler, London Oct 24th 2013

Identifying key findings

High-priority: people fail, or abandon the task

Medium: people succeed but are frustrated and unhappy

Low: people would enjoy the app more if...

Tip: Work hard to prioritise the highest-impact items. You can’t fix everything.

ANALYSING & PRESENTING FINDINGS
